WebJun 2, 2016 · Miles to go. Collectively, Walmart’s fleet drivers log approximately 700 million miles per year. The average Walmart truck driver logs more than 100,000 miles annually – the equivalent of about four trips around the world! And they work with safety in mind: The fleet has been named the “Safest Fleet” of its kind 12 out of the last 16 years. WebAug 13, 2024 · Control for the Right Reasons. Aside from removing tariffs, duties or taxes from specific in-demand goods, governments can enforce import and export quotas. Import quotas control the amount or volume of a commodity that can be imported into a country during a specified time. Quotas are guided by the Harmonized Tariff System (HS) codes …
